Keep a Complete Payment History in Salesforce Without Manual Logging
Successful payments are the best news, but they get buried in Stripe notifications. Notis automatically logs every successful invoice as a note in Salesforce so your customer transaction history is complete and searchable in one place.
Trigger
Invoice Payment Succeeded Trigger
Triggered when an invoice payment is successful in Stripe
Action
Create note
Creates a new note attached to a salesforce record with the specified title and content.
Why this helps
Payment confirmations stay in Stripe emails. Your Salesforce customer record has no record of the transactions, so you can't see your relationship value at a glance.
- Every payment is logged in Salesforce automatically
- Customer payment history is visible alongside your relationship notes
- Complete financial context without switching between systems

Questions about this workflow
Can I format the note nicely?
Yes. Use your prompt to specify: 'Format the note as: Payment of $X received on [date] for invoice #[number].' Notis handles the formatting.
What if I want the note on a specific record type (opportunity, lead, etc.)?
Tell Notis in your prompt: 'Log the note on the account record' or 'Log it on the related opportunity.' Notis links it correctly.
How far back does this look at Stripe invoices?
By default, Notis processes invoices as they complete in real-time. Historical invoices aren't retroactively logged unless you request a one-time sync.
